L’Oréal has once again demonstrated its ability to maintain its trajectory of dual performance.
The Group has consolidated its position as the world leader in beauty, sustained its growth and strengthened its margins. Our brand portfolio – already the most diverse in the industry – has been further enriched, opening up formidable new opportunities.
On the corporate citizenship front, our resolve remains intact. This is reflected in the triple A rating awarded by CDP, which L’Oréal is the only company in the world to have achieved over ten consecutive years. The stability of our governance is our strategic strength for the long term. It was further consolidated in 2025 by the enduring bond between the founding Bettencourt Meyers family and L’Oréal, through the presence on the Board of Jean-Victor Meyers and Nicolas Meyers, alongside the Téthys holding company – L’Oréal’s primary shareholder, where Françoise Bettencourt Meyers acts as chair. In the face of shifting market dynamics, the Board rigorously oversaw the strategy, particularly within the Luxe division and the resilience of our positions in the United States and China. Our annual seminar in India allowed us to witness first-hand its exceptional potential as a future growth engine. The Board also explored the new frontiers of beauty, from longevity to strategic acquisitions.
